Using WEAR - AMI, ARIS and Ergodata demonstrations
WEAR is an international collaborative effort to create a worldwide resource of anthropometric data for a wide variety of engineering applications. The workshop will introduce participants to an internet webpage portal that allows access to millions of data points from around the world and will showcase tools to analyze these data.
Participants will have temporary access to the WEAR network for 7 days. They will be able to navigate the database and do basic statistical analysis during the tutorial.

Fitmapping - glove exercise
Fit mapping is determining who a product fits well and who it does not. This tutorial will show you how to make a fit map for a glove. We will measure the hand, then measure the garment, assess the hand in the garment and see who it fits and who it doesn’t. You will be shown how to use this information to do an analysis in Excel to recommend improvements in the size and fit range.
Participants will gain an understanding about the process of making a fit map and also grasp the concept of making your own fit map for your own designs.

Extended version of WPAFB “train your digital man model”
This workshop provides a comparison between the Human Model shown in the last session and a real person of the same measurements. This presentation verifies that the measurements of the digital man model is really the same as the real person and when they are not the same, it shows how to manage any discrepancies
Participants will gain an understanding of the benefits and limitations of an existing digital man model.

Integrate
Overlay two 3-D scans and see the differences in shape and size. This software has been developed by the US government as an anthropometric measuring tool.
This workshop will introduce you to INTEGRATE 2. 8 which is a Linux or Windows-based software package, to visualize, analyze, and manipulate three-dimensional topographic data. The analysis capability represented by this software is robust, flexible, and instrumental in applying 3-D anthropometry toward the improved fit of protective equipment, clothing, commercial head gear, and medical devices.
Integrate (full version) will be distributed free to participants along with tutorials and a manual.
Statistical Shape Analysis
This tutorial introduces the basic concepts of statistical shape analysis and how it is used for processing 3D anthropometric data.
Participants will gain an understanding of the latest state of the art analysis of 3D body scan data. This type of analysis is the future of anthropometry.
